THE SERIES AGAINST UTEP- UTEP comes into Thursday's game with FIU holding a commanding 5-1 series lead, dating back to the 1998-99 season ... The Panthers are 0-2 at home, 1-2 in El Paso, and 0-1 in neutral site games with that contest taking place last season in the Conference USA quarterfinals ... The Miners handed FIU a season-ending 83-71 loss.
Â
- In their last meeting, FIU posted a thrilling 79-69 win at UTEP on Jan. 23 to complete a sweep of the Lone Star state ... FIU led for all but 3:15 of the game, and by as many as 21 points - 64-43 with 10:43 left in the game - before the Miners staged a furious comeback to cut the lead to three, 70-67 with 2:48 left ...
Eric Nottage, however, stopped the bleeding and ended a four-plus minute scoring drought, hitting his only field goal of the game, a three-point shot, with 2:22 left in the game to put the Panthers up 73-67 ...
Adrian Diaz led three FIU players in double-digits with 20 points ...
Daviyon Draper chipped in 17 points and 10 rebounds for his fifth double-double of the season - and second straight - and the sixth of his career ...
Donte McGill also added 16 points.

LAST TIME OUT FOR THE PANTHERS- FIU is coming off a tough 67-66 loss at Middle Tennessee on Saturday night ... The setback marked the Panthers' fourth-straight loss.
Â
-
Daviyon Draper scored a career-high tying - and game-high - 25 points in the loss, while
Donte McGill added 15 points and a game-high nine rebounds ... McGill's double figures snapped his two-game double-digit scoring drought, his longest stretch since scoring eight and nine points, respectively in the first two games of the season.
Â
- The Panthers shot 51.0 percent (26-of-51) from the field and outrebounded the Blue Raiders, 38-29. FIU, however, committed 14 turnovers which led to 16 Middle Tennessee points off turnovers.
